Best time to go to Old Harry Rocks

The best time to visit Old Harry Rocks is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July and August are its hottest month on average. At the time of August,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January43.2°F (6.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February43.5°F (6.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
March45.3°F (7.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April48.6°F (9.2°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
May53.6°F (12.0°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
June59.0°F (15.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
July62.4°F (16.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
August62.4°F (16.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
September59.7°F (15.4°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nyAverageAverage
October55.6°F (13.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
November49.6°F (9.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
December46.0°F (7.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age

What can I see and do near Old Harry Rocks?

You'll want to browse the exhibits at Swanage Museum and Heritage Centre and Langton Matravers Museum. Spend some time exploring the the natural beauty of Studland Beach and Nature Reserve, Compton Acres and Durlston Country Park. Enjoy a stroll along the shore at Swanage Beach, Sandbanks Beach and Alum Chine Beach.
